It was almost ten o'clock at night. From the master bedroom on the second floor came the heartbreaking cries of a newborn baby. The cries had not stopped for almost thirty minutes. Earlier that evening, Kai Torez had received an urgent phone call from the family restaurant. One of the managers had informed him that a problem had broken out between customers, forcing Kai to leave immediately
Only four days had passed since you gave birth to your beautiful baby boy, Eden Torez. Your body was still recovering from childbirth. Tonight was one of those nights. Eden simply wouldn't stop crying. His tiny face had turned bright red from sobbing. His little fists were tightly clenched, his small body trembling every time he let out another desperate cry. You had already tried everything. No matter what you did... Eden continued crying. Minutes felt like hours. Baby blues.
Your arms had begun shaking from exhaustion. Afraid that your trembling hands might accidentally hurt him, you carefully laid Eden down in the middle of the bed, making sure soft pillows surrounded him so he would be safe.Even then...He kept crying.
You slowly stepped backward until your back touched the bedroom wall.Your knees suddenly gave out beneath you.You slid down into the corner of the room, hugging your legs tightly against your chest. Tears streamed endlessly down your face as your breathing became uneven. You covered both ears with trembling hands, desperately trying to block out the heartbreaking sound. But no matter how tightly you covered them... You could still hear Eden crying. You cried with him. Mother and son.
Click. The bedroom door suddenly swung open. A pair of expensive heels echoed sharply across the wooden floor. Standing at the doorway was Ross Torez. Kai's mother.
She had heard her grandson crying from downstairs and immediately came upstairs. However, instead of concern, her face was filled with irritation. Her sharp gaze landed on Eden crying helplessly on the bed before shifting toward you, curled up in the corner with tears covering your face.
Disgust flashed across her expression. She crossed her arms tightly over her chest.
"What are you doing, you crazy woman?!"
Her voice was loud enough to make you flinch.
"Why are you sitting there crying instead of calming your son? He's been crying for half an hour!"
She walked straight toward you. Standing over your trembling figure, she looked down at you with nothing but disappointment. Then she nudged your leg with her foot, forcing you to shift slightly on the floor.
"You're completely useless. You can't even take care of your own son. Tell me, how are you supposed to take care of my son?,You're weak. You're incompet-"
The bedroom door suddenly opened once again. Kai had returned home.The shopping bag in his hand slipped onto the floor the moment his eyes took in the scene before him. His son crying. His wife curled up in the corner, shaking and sobbing. And his own mother standing over her He immediately knelt beside you, gently wrapping both arms around your trembling body
He stared directly at his mother.
"...Mom?"
His voice was calm.Too calm.The kind of calm that came just before a storm.
"What did you just say to my wife?, I heard everything."
